Dear Clients & Visitors to our Gallery:
On Friday, January 17, Al Hirschfeld signed his final edition of lithographs. It was this Charlie Chaplin, shown walking away, inspired by the close of many Chaplin silent films in which Chaplin strode away from the viewer. Its title:
"The End."

The Birthday
Gift
June 21,
2002
Dear Al,
and whosoever shall read this,
Once
again I was met with the adventure of selecting a gift for your
birthday on June 21st. This became a more daunting job
than it would seem: You and I have been together for 33 yearsso
that's been, how many presents so far? Thirty-two birthday presents,
33 half-birthday presents (a tradition between us), and many Chanukah
giftsa total of almost 100 gifts in all. The first one (remember?)
was an electric pencil sharpener that would light up and sing while
it sharpened. More recently I gifted you with one of those gripper
things that you could use to pick up the personal letters you writewhich
by habit get thrown on the floor of your studio until they are ready
to be
stamped and mailed.
But
now, completely out of ideas for more gadgets and gifts, I awakened
one morning with an idea, and so: the Gallery asked our favorite
friends and clients to record their birthday wishes for you and
the world to see and hear. When we began deciding whom to invite
onto the website, we found our cup gushing over, and for this reasonand
because all birthdays should be celebrated for at least a
yearwe've decided to keep these felicitations and personal
anecdotes online for this year, adding to them
as appropriate.
This
is my gift. My birthday wishes are the total of those that you will
hear,
and then some.
Oh
yesand when you've finished listening to all your accolades,
you can go to our Online Gallery and look at all your work!
